I installed a small powered subwoofer (JVC CS-BB2, see link below) in the empty space beneath the driver's seat in the cavity Ron mentions. The existing foam material under the seat prevents it from sliding around and buzzing, the bass is right where you can feel it, it's easy to power from the aux battery, and the subwoofer's volume knob can dangle through the gap at the front of the seat pedestal just under your knees for convenient access while driving.

The unit won't wake up the neighbors, but it is well suited for my needs. I think the cavity is also well suited for an amp. I don't have a seat swivel on my driver's side (weekender), so I can't say if the unit would fit if you have swivels.
